随着区块链技术的发展和加密货币交易的日益普及,越来越多的用户和企业开始使用数字钱包进行资产管理。TPWallet作为一款功能强大的数字钱包应用,提供了多种便利的管理工具。其中,自动转账功能尤其受到用户的关注。本篇文章将详细探讨TPWallet的自动转账功能,帮助用户理解如何利用脚本来简化转账过程。
#### TPWallet是什么?TPWallet是一款支持多种数字资产管理的钱包应用,具有安全性高、操作简便等优点。它不仅支持多种主流加密货币,比如比特币、以太坊等,还提供了便捷的资产管理功能。用户可以通过TPWallet实时查看资产状况,进行资产交易、转账等操作。
#### 为什么需要自动转账?对于经常进行大额交易或日常小额转账的用户来说,手动操作不仅繁琐,还可能因为繁忙而导致延误。自动转账可以有效提高效率,确保资金快速到账,尤其在高频交易的场景下,自动化操作显得尤为重要。
#### 如何使用TPWallet进行自动转账?在使用TPWallet进行自动转账之前,用户需要确保已安装该钱包,并具备基本的加密货币知识。以下是具体的步骤:首先,用户需要根据自己的操作系统选择合适的TPWallet版本进行安装。安装完成后,用户可以通过设置页面创建一个新的钱包,并导入已有资产。
接下来的步骤是编写对应的自动转账脚本。用户可以使用Python等编程语言来实现该功能。脚本需要包括钱包地址、转账金额、交易手续费等信息。同时,为了确保交易的成功,用户需要关注网络状态和钱包余额。
#### TPWallet自动转账脚本示例以下是一个简单的TPWallet自动转账脚本示例。此脚本利用Python编写,能够定时进行指定金额的转账:
```python import time from tpwallet import Wallet # 初始化钱包 wallet = Wallet('your_wallet_address', 'your_private_key') # 定义转账函数 def auto_transfer(amount, recipient): try: wallet.send(recipient, amount) print(f'Transferred {amount} to {recipient} successfully!') except Exception as e: print(f'Error occurred: {e}') # 定时转账 while True: auto_transfer(0.1, 'recipient_wallet_address') time.sleep(3600) # 每小时自动转账一次 ``` #### 安全性与风险管理在进行自动转账时,用户需要特别注意安全性。一方面,私钥必须妥善保管,避免泄露。用户可以通过多因素认证等方式提高账户的安全性。另一方面,用户需要定期检查转账记录,确保没有异常交易发生。
#### 常见问题解答(FAQ) #####TPWallet的网络支持情况如何?
TPWallet支持多种网络如以太坊、比特币等,它允许用户在不同的区块链上进行转账。这为用户提供了更大的灵活性,也意味着用户需要了解每个网络的转账规则和费用结构。
#####使用自动转账是否需要编程知识?
虽然掌握一定的编程知识能够帮助用户更好地使用TPWallet的自动转账脚本,但TPWallet的用户界面也相对友好,普通用户可以通过图形界面的设置进行部分自动转账操作。
#####如何保证转账的及时性?
为了保证转账的及时性,用户可以选择在交易高峰期之外进行操作。此外,适当提高手续费也有助于加快交易确认速度。
#####如果转账失败,如何处理?
用户应及时查看转账记录,了解失败原因。一般而言,转账失败可能是由于网络拥堵或余额不足等问题。用户可以根据具体情况进行相应调整,重新发起转账。
#####脚本的与性能提升方案
根据实际需求,用户可以设置更复杂的转账逻辑,比如批量转账或根据市场行情自动调整转账金额。这需要对代码进行进一步的,以提高其执行效率。
#####是否可以在移动设备上实现自动转账?
目前,TPWallet的移动版本已经实现了基本的自动转账功能,但用户仍需注意移动设备的安全性,如使用强密码、定期更新软件等。
### 总结TPWallet的自动转账功能为用户提供了便捷的资产管理方式,通过合理使用脚本用户可以实现高效的资金流动和管理。同时,用户在使用过程中要注意安全性,保障自身资产安全。